@yerpaljesus
This happened @ Emo Dry Bulk terminal @ Rotterdam
Appearantly the hoisting equipment malfunctioned and snapped a ling?¿ (not sure about the name. woven strand of hoisting equipment like 15ft long)
And dropped this excavator like 25meters down. no1 got hurt. as no1 is allowed down the hold when hoisting ;)
